Apr 7, 2014 · Each 90‐meter cell was categorized as not flat, flat, flatter, or flattest, and each state was measured in terms of percentage flat, flatter, and flattest as well as absolute area in each category. Ultimately, forty‐eight states plus the District of Columbia were mapped and ranked according to these values.Dec 29, 2018 · Posted on 29 December 2018 by John. I read somewhere that, contrary to popular belief, Kansas is not the flattest state in the US. Instead, Florida is the flattest, and Kansas was several notches further down the list. ( Update: Nevertheless, Kansas is literally flatter than a pancake. Thanks to Andreas Krause for the link in the comments.) Also these …Flatness can apply to either an outside surface of a part or a centerplane. When flatness applies to an outside surface, the feature control frame points at that surface or is on an extension line connected to that surface. The surface then, must fall between two parallel planes that in this case are 0.1mm apart.What is the flattest state list? Even better would be to create a grid of squares 10 miles per side and do the above calculations, adjusting for partial squares.Nov 28, 2014 · Measuring the flatness of Kansas presented us with a greater challenge than measuring the flatness of the pancake. The state is so flat that the off-the-shelf software produced a flatness value for it of 1. This value was, as they say, too good to be true, so we did a more complex analysis, and after many hours of programmingIn order of flatness: Florida, Illinois, North Dakota, Louisiana, Minnesota, Delaware, Kansas.
